General Information
Codeep Cultural association is a non-profit, non-governmental organisation. Its structure is organised by its presedent, co-president, council of members and cashier. Budgetary resources are from national public resources and EU funding. Membership fee represents only a minor degree in its budget. Modalities of action are: artist in residence programme, research platform, public interventions, festivals and mediatheque. Main partners come from international sphere.
Mission and Objectives

Codeep's mission has been reorganised in 2008 in the form of Museum of Transitory Art - MoTA,
and we are in the process of formal registration. Our mission is to develop artistic projects in contemporary inter-media art. Our objectives are constant research for the new, unknown and undefined, development of transitory form of museum, which is museum without time and space, development of artist in residence network in the Balkan and East European region, etc.

Main Projects / Activities

Main projects are:
Artist Talk: Culture and Knowledge Platform - european project, involving 6 partners
Tribe: Artist in residence network in the Balkan and East Europe
Mediatheque: an open source library of contemporary art
Dark Star: an interactive monument for public space
New Human: actualisation of socialist monuments
Public Avatar: a new project documenting the relationship between virtual reality and our perceptions of self and society

General Information
Cona, institute for contemporary arts processing is NGO cultural institution based in Ljubljana, Slovenia. Its main activity is production of contemporary art projects. Cona institute has an artistic director and producer and co-operates with various authors. Budgetary resources available per year are 30.000eur. Sources of funding are: Ministry of culture of Slovenia, Ljubljana City Municipality, international foundation and self financing activities. Modalities of action: intermedia and music arts production, publishing and education. Main partners; Intima Virtual Base, CoLaboRadio, KIOSK, Radio Slovenia, No-FM Beograd, free103point9 New York, ŠKUC Ljubljana, City art museum Ljubljana, Museum of Modern Art, RAM Live Roma, Roma Radio Art Fair.
Mission and Objectives

Our mission and objectives is to produce, research, develop and exhibit contemporary arts projects and to collaborate with individuals and organizations working on same art field.

Main Projects / Activities

Intermedia arts:
- long term project radioCona, with art works productions, FM and stream broadcasts and exhibitions, radioCona collaborates with more than 120 individuals and 15 international institutions. http://www.radiocona.si/
- long term project Ballettika Internettikka http://www.intima.org/bi/index.html
Sound arts: ZVO.ČI.TI so.und.ing Collection, A podcast collection of Slovenian contemporary sound art

General Information
A working unit within the Faculty of Arts. AE research/development centre will comprise the Unit for Anthropology of the Mediterranean. 23 staff (12 teachers and assistants; 3 administrative staff, 1 researcher and 7 junior research fellows). Budget estimation: 400.000 EUR – public funds plus other sources. Organisers of annual symposium Mess (Mediterranean Ethnological Summer Symposium). Main parters from the Mediterranean countries are coming from Italy, Croatia, Greece, France, Spain and Portugal. Bilateral research projects, teaching exchange and other kinds of dissemination of knowledge.
Mission and Objectives

The main aim of the Department is to provide the best possible education to students of ethnology and cultural anthropology. The aim of the research and development centre is to support teaching and to bridge the gap between academia and the general society, especially its economic structure.
A very important aim of the institution is to enable young people (students) to communicate with others and to challenge prejudices, racisms and other deviations in European neoliberal societies.

Main Projects / Activities

Slovene Identities in the Context of the European Space. Basic research programme, 2004-2009.
Ethnological Analyses of Representations and Heritage. Basic research project, 2004-2007.
Development Partnership in the Field of Integration for Asylum Applicants: Equal, 2004-2008 (partner).
The Concept of Time and Space in East and West European Folklore. Bilateral research project with the Centro de Ci?ncias Humanes e Sociais, Universidade do Algarve, Faro, Portugal.
RAMSES II: Réseau euro-méditerranéen des centres de recherche en sciences humaines sur l’aire méditerranéenne – Euro-Mediterranean Network of Excellence of Research Centers in Humanities. (6th Framework Programme.) 2005-2008 (partner).

General Information
Design center has been established as a private company in 2002. It is an independent organization working on the design, art, research and education areas. Design center is gathering designers, artists, practitioners, theoreticians and other professionals in Southeast Europe with the purpose to establish intercultural and intersocial platform where independent culture, art and education can meet. Design center has no fully employed persons and is working on project based staff members. Design center is included in international networks of ICOGRADA and ADC-Art Directors Club.  Sources of funding: Ministry of Culture of Republic of Slovenia, City of Ljubljana, donations, granst and a part of the revenues come from business activities.  
Mission and Objectives

Design center is working on improvement, development and stimulation of high quality design, art, craftsmanship, culture and education in Southeast Europe. That includes organisation of the projects, programms and events of exhibitions, lectures, seminars, social projects and other relevant activities. The main objectiv is to stimulate and contribute in the development of the region through inclusion of all relevant disciplines that Design center is working at. Through creation of open space for research, production and distribution of the ideas and products, Design center is raising awareness of the importance of the local based actions in the global thinking alternatives.

General Information
The African Center of Slovenia is organized as an association, open to anyone who, regardless of nationality, is interested in the activities of the association. The main activities of the association are funded by public tenders and focus on the field of economy, culture, social affairs, tourist activities, sports, humanitarian assistance and the field of science and education.
Mission and Objectives

The objectives of the African Center of Slovenia are: to unite and empower the African diaspora in Slovenia, to connect and unite individuals who have a positive interest in Africa, to positively raise awareness about Africa, to support specific development incentives in Africa, to connect African and Slovenian cultures and to portray a balanced image of Africa.

Main Projects / Activities

The African Center of Slovenia focuses its activities on organizing round tables and discussions, presentations, lectures, preparation of brochures, projects, workshops, assistance to members of the African diaspora and members of the African Center of Slovenia, media watch, cultural and literary evenings, drum and dance workshops, mentoring and encouragement, musical entertainment and sporting events.
